in ChiantiPy, the N_j/N is included. The only difference is that in ChiantiPy, the emissivity is per steradian (1/4 pi). Multiply it by 4*pi and it should be the same as the IDL result.

This seems to contradict the emiss method docstring which says that the result in the emiss field has units of erg cm^-3 s^-1 sr^-1 so multiplying through by 4pi still gives erg cm^-3 s^-1. So where does the cm^-3 come from?

Looking at the source code more closely, it seems that the units listed in the documentation should actually be erg s^-1 sr^-1 (or photons s^-1 sr^-1, depending on the default settings) since emiss in this case is just the product between the population (unitless), the A value (s^-1) and the energy factor (erg or photons).
